Location Overstrand is a most attractive and increasingly popular seaside village on the North Norfolk coast at the heart of Poppyland which in the latter part of the 19th Century was catapulted into prominence and became known as the village of millionaires, boasting many architectural gems including The Pleasance, former home of Lord and Lady Battersea, Overstrand Hall, former home of Baron and Lady Hillingdon and the Methodist Church all designed by the world renowned architect Sir Edwin Lutyens. Past visitors to the village include Winston Churchill, Jesse Boot, the Founder of Boots the Chemist, the Chivers (jam) Family and Clement Scott, writer for the Daily Telegraph.

Overstrand, part of an Area Of Outstanding Natural Beauty, offers both coast and countryside walks and visitors are drawn to its lovely beach and good range of local amenities and facilities to include a convenience store/post office on the High Street, alongside the White Horse public house, primary school with older children catered for at Cromer Academy, church, village hall and art centre. In addition, there is an excellent garden centre with its own café, the stunning Sea Marge Hotel, beautiful sandy beaches and well known cliff top café. Regular bus services take you to North Walsham (8 miles) and Cromer (3 miles) and hourly to Norwich, Sheringham and Holt.
